Extension 1: Oxford & Highclere Castle — Viking’s Highest-Rated Extension

Three nights. The English countryside. Viking’s most acclaimed pre/post cruise experience. Here is exactly what happens:

 

Day 1: Arrival — Champagne Welcome & Oxford


Transfer from your cruise disembarkation point to Oxford by private coach. Check in to a premium Oxford hotel and receive Viking’s signature champagne welcome. The afternoon is yours to explore the city at leisure before an orientation walk.


Day 2: Oxford University & Blenheim Palace


Morning: Privileged Access to the University of Oxford, founded in 1096 and the alma mater of kings, presidents, prime ministers, and poets. Viking’s exclusive access takes guests behind doors closed to the standard public tour. Afternoon: Blenheim Palace, the birthplace of Sir Winston Churchill and a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Built in 1705, Blenheim is one of the grandest country houses in England and one of the most visited historic properties in the country. Afternoon tea on the estate.


Day 3: Highclere Castle, The Real Downton Abbey


The centerpiece of the extension and the reason Viking’s guests rate it their highest-ever experience. Viking’s Privileged Access to Highclere Castle goes beyond the standard visitor experience it is a personal encounter with one of England’s great country estates, made possible exclusively through Viking’s 10-year partnership with the Carnarvon family.


What Viking guests experience at Highclere that standard visitors do not:


• A Privileged Access tour of the castle's state rooms, private rooms, and Egyptian collection, including artifacts from the 5th Earl's sponsorship of Howard Carter's discovery of Tutankhamun's tomb


•  Meeting long-serving members of the Highclere estate staff the people who make Downton Abbey feel like a real working home, not a film set


• Private access to areas of the estate not on the public tour route


• The personal connection to the Carnarvon family story that Karine Hagen's decade-long relationship with Lady Fiona Carnarvon has built


• The estate grounds, walled gardens, and parkland in conditions that standard day visitors never experience


This is not a museum visit. It is a private encounter with a living English country estate that has been in the Carnarvon family for generations. It feels like being invited to a friend’s home that happens to be one of the most beautiful buildings in England.

Extension 3: British Collections of Ancient Egypt — For Nile River Cruise Guests


Five nights. Pre-cruise only. Available exclusively for guests booked on Viking’s Pharaohs & Pyramids Nile River itinerary.


This is the most intellectually specific of the three extensions and the one that rewards the most curious traveler. The 5th Earl of Carnarvon whose family still owns Highclere Castle today was the financial patron of archaeologist Howard Carter and was present at the opening of Tutankhamun’s tomb in 1922. The artifacts he brought back from Egypt before his sudden death in Cairo are still housed at Highclere Castle today.

 

•  Highclere Castle’s Egyptian collection — a private viewing of the artifacts the 5th Earl brought back from the Carnarvon/Carter excavation, including items connected directly to the Tutankhamun discovery


•   British Museum Egyptian galleries — among the finest collections of ancient Egyptian artifacts outside Egypt, with a guided focus on the Carter and Carnarvon expedition story


•   Retracing the footsteps of Howard Carter — the specific sites in England and at Highclere connected to the man who spent 15 years excavating before finding the most famous tomb in history


•   Full historical and Egyptological context for what guests will experience on the Nile — arriving in Egypt already knowing the story of the discovery, the people involved, and the political circumstances surrounding it

 

Why this extension matters: Most travelers arrive in Egypt with general knowledge of the Pyramids and Tutankhamun. This extension arrives with specific, personal, and emotionally resonant context rooted in the actual family whose home many of them have watched on television for years. The connection between Highclere Castle and the Valley of the Kings is one of the most extraordinary coincidences in the history of exploration and Viking is the only cruise line that makes it available as a coherent journey.

Frequently Asked Questions: Viking Downton Abbey & Highclere Castle


 

Can I visit Highclere Castle on a Viking cruise?


Yes. Viking has offered exclusive Privileged Access to Highclere Castle, the filming location of Downton Abbey, since 2014 through a partnership with the Earl and Countess of Carnarvon. The access is available on three different pre- and post-cruise extensions: Oxford & Highclere Castle (3 nights, available on select river and ocean cruises), Great Homes, Gardens & Gin (4 to 5 nights, available on select river and ocean cruises), and British Collections of Ancient Egypt (5 nights pre-cruise, available for Nile River cruise guests only). The experiences are co-created with the Carnarvon family and are available exclusively through Viking.


What is the difference between Oxford & Highclere Castle and Great Homes, Gardens & Gin?


Oxford & Highclere Castle is a 3-night extension focused on the University of Oxford, Blenheim Palace (Churchill’s birthplace), and Highclere Castle. It is Viking’s highest-rated cruise extension overall and is available on select Paris river cruises, the London/Paris/D-Day river itinerary, and the British Isles Explorer ocean cruise. Great Homes, Gardens & Gin is a 4 to 5-night extension that adds Broughton Castle (Wolf Hall, the Fiennes family home), Chavenage House (Poldark), and the Bombay Sapphire distillery at Laverstock Mill, alongside the Highclere Castle visit. It is designed for PBS MASTERPIECE viewers who want to experience multiple British estates across different series.


What is the Viking British Collections of Ancient Egypt extension?


The British Collections of Ancient Egypt is a 5-night pre-cruise extension available exclusively for guests booked on Viking’s Pharaohs & Pyramids Nile River cruise itinerary. It retraces the story of archaeologist Howard Carter and his patron the 5th Earl of Carnarvon — whose family still owns Highclere Castle today. Highlights include a private viewing of the Egyptian artifact collection at Highclere Castle, the British Museum’s Egyptian galleries, and full historical context for the discovery of Tutankhamun’s tomb that guests are about to retrace on the Nile.


Which Viking river cruises include the Highclere Castle extension?


The Oxford & Highclere Castle extension is available on select departures of Paris & the Heart of Normandy, Cities of Light, and London, Paris & D-Day river cruises. The Great Homes, Gardens & Gin extension is available on select Rhine Getaway river cruise departures. The British Collections of Ancient Egypt extension is available pre-cruise on the Pharaohs & Pyramids Nile River itinerary.
